Arman Tsarukyan's Rise to the Top: A Tale of Social Media Savvy and UFC Glory
Arman Tsarukyan, the Armenian lightweight contender, has been making waves in the UFC, and it's not just because of his fighting prowess. His journey to the top five of the UFC's biggest stars is a fascinating tale of strategic social media engagement and a unique relationship with online personality Nina Drama.
The Social Media Savvy
What makes Tsarukyan's success story particularly intriguing is his ability to leverage social media to his advantage. By forming a close relationship with Nina Drama, he has not only increased his online presence but also garnered a massive following. With six million Instagram followers, he's now a household name in the UFC, surpassing some of the sport's biggest stars.
Nina Drama, an online personality who collaborates with select UFC fighters, has played a pivotal role in Tsarukyan's rise. Her interviews and social media content have helped build his brand and attract a global audience. This strategic partnership showcases the power of influencer marketing in the world of sports.
A Contender's Journey
Tsarukyan's journey to the top hasn't been without its challenges. After a dominant performance against Dan Hooker in November, he found himself on the sidelines, awaiting a title shot. However, his focus on social media and his relationship with Nina Drama have kept him in the public eye, ensuring his relevance in the UFC.
The Top Five Debate
Dana White, the UFC boss, recently placed Tsarukyan in the top five of the UFC's biggest stars, crediting his social media work with Nina Drama. This move is a strategic one, as it keeps the contender in the spotlight and maintains his popularity. It also highlights the importance of a well-rounded approach to building a fighter's brand.
